Anti-Corruption Front


Natalia Munika. Photo: Antikor

On May 19, the National Agency for the Prevention of Corruption reported that it had found falsehoods worth 15.1 million hryvnias in the declaration of Natalia Munika, head of the tax audit department of the Southern Interregional Department of the State Tax Service for Large Taxpayers.

The National Agency for the Prevention of Corruption conducted a full audit of the declaration of Andriy Babenko, a member of the Odesa Regional Council and founder of the Samson security agency, and found a number of violations and false statements. In particular, Babenko indicated more than UAH 17 million in income, but could not confirm where the money came from. He was not officially engaged in entrepreneurial activity, so he could not have earned such amounts. In total, the audit revealed false information worth more than UAH 28 million.

In the declaration of Oleksandra Smyrna, a former employee of Odesa Regional State Administration, inconsistencies totaling UAH 23 million were found. The woman faces criminal liability, and she has already resigned and moved abroad.
